Signs the old tank has run its course

Four signs tell you the conversation should move from patching to swapping:

Brown or metallic-tasting hot water

The cylinder liner has given up, and no repair reverses that.

Water weeping from a seam or pooling at the base

Terminal, and the only question is how many days are left.

Callouts stacking up

A second element or valve visit within a couple of years on an old unit is money into a losing cause.

Less hot water than the household used to get

A silted tank heats less whatever the thermostat claims.

Choosing what goes where the old tank sat

The changeover is the natural moment to change technologies if the old setup no longer suits. The four paths we install:

Heat pump

Draws warmth from the surrounding air instead of making it, and frost is barely a factor here at an average of 0.3 frost days a year. Suburb-level install counts already sit around 1,690 units.

Solar hot water

Roof collectors do the heavy lifting through the warm months, with a booster covering the cloudy stretch. Roughly 1,604 solar installs already sit on roofs in this suburb.

Gas continuous flow

Compact wall-hung units that free up floor space, a tidy path where an updated gas connection already exists.

Electric storage

The straightforward like-for-like option when the old unit was electric and the budget calls for simple.

We size the new unit to the household, not to the old tank's nameplate. A family of five and a retired couple use hot water very differently, and an oversized tank is just a bigger bill waiting.

What a replacement costs

Two things drive the figure, and both go on the quote before any work begins:

How close the new unit is to the old one

Swapping like for like is the shorter job. Changing technologies adds new valves, different piping and compliance work on top.

Access

A tank on a level pad with a clear side gate is quick. A unit under a house on a slope, or in a tight apartment cupboard, takes twice the handling.

Hot water replacement questions we hear

How do I know my tank is finished?

Brown water from the hot tap, weeping seams, or a second repair call on an ageing unit all point to replacement rather than another patch.

How long does the changeover take?

Swapping like for like on a clear pad is a half-day job for most homes. Changing technologies adds valves, piping and compliance work on top.

Can you take the old system away?

Yes. The old tank comes off the property with us and is disposed of properly, so no rusted cylinder is left waiting for a council pickup.

Which system suits the Hunter climate best?

Heat pump and solar units both perform well here, and install counts already run into the thousands. We weigh roof space, gas and usage first.

Do you replace systems in units and apartments?

Yes. Compact tanks and tricky shared access take more planning, so we coordinate timing and carry-in properly for any multi-dwelling building.
